Wisconsin Clerk Education Fund (WCEF) was established to promote the education and training of clerks!  The Fund’s purpose is to raise funds for municipal clerk scholarships to WMCA conferences.  Every dollar you donate helps promote education.

Our goal for 2022 is to be able to offer $8,000.00 in scholarships.  Help us reach that goal!

 District Meetings Coming Soon

March 10th has a couple of options for our members:
District 4 is having a 2 hour Zoom meeting with Department of Revenue Alcohol and Tobacco Enforement Agents Zachary Dolan and Derrick Schleis.  They will be talking about the basics of Alcohol and Tobacco licensing, renewals, wine walks and permits. Since there is no travel involved, any member from any part of the state could register for this meeting.  Click here to register today.

District 7 & 8
have teamed up to bring you a full day of in-person education with the Ethics Commission; Wisconsin Elections Commission and DOR Alcohol Agents.  Click here to check out the details of the classes and to register to join in on the meeting in Rothschild at the Holiday Inn.

 Northern Training for New Clerks is Coming Back
 In-person training geared to new clerks is coming back in May in Minocqua!  If you have been on the job for less than 2 years, mark your calendars for May 12-13 to join your fellow clerks for two days of training for you.  Watch your email for registration information by the first part of March.  Classes will include election training; Board of Review; and classes about minutes; open meetings; records management, and more.
 Board of Review Zoom Classes
 FYI - The new 2022 Board of Review certification video and information packet produced by the UW-Extension in Madison is almost ready.  We will be scheduling Zoom classes for the second half of April and into May.  Watch for the March E-Newsletter for registration details.

The UW-Green Bay Virtual Institute is a series of interactive, live online sessions via Zoom with some courses being held online through self-guided learning. Participants select and register for their track, and UW-Green Bay provides links so that participants can join the cohort live.

Pros of Virtual Learning

  • Learn from the comfort of your own home or office
  • No lodging or travel costs
  • Easy digital access to learning materials
  • Less time away from the office

The UW-GB Clerks and Treasurers Institute in Green Bay is truly the premiere place to learn the skills you need to be the best Professional Clerk you can be. Aside from the institute being held virtually again this year, therefore saving your municipality money for travel expenses, the WMCA has scholarships available for any Clerk planning to attend the Clerks Institute. Applications must be postmarked by April 15. All members are encouraged to apply for a scholarship no matter which year of the institute you are in – Year 1, 2 or 3 or Clerks Completion.  Remember, Clerks Completion is the 4th year taken after doing the Treasurers Institute.

In 2021, we awarded 35 scholarships with 11 going to first year members, 15 going to second year members, and 9 going to third year members.  These scholarships totaled over $17,000.

Please ensure that you are an active member and include a letter of support from your supervisor or elected official.  Over 15% of applications were rejected in the past due to lack of membership or letters of support! Additionally, the Committee often makes their decisions based on narratives in each category. We would ask that you put more thought into your answers, demonstrating both the financial need of a scholarship, as well as what it would mean to advance your education.
